    hi David seeing as there's no cpc on the lights what test you doing on and what you recording on test sheet

    • @dsesuk
      @dsesuk  Месяц назад +1

      For R1+R2, R2, and Zs, the test result is N/A. It's still worth doing an IR test L-N to the main earth bar as a leakage fault could occur between live parts and earth even if that earth isn't via a dedicated CPC in which case the result is (hopefully) in the MegaOhm range.

    Which do think is better the earth sure or the Irish twin and earth that you had a roll of?

    • @dsesuk
      @dsesuk  Месяц назад +1

      I liked the Irish cable for its CPC sleeving, however I didn't like the CPC being the same CSA as line/neutral as is standard in Europe. While not a problem on 1mm - 2.5mm cable, I can see it being quite cumbersome on 6mm or 10mm circuits, especially when Irish wiring accessories are based more on the UK style than the European gear. Most switches and sockets are designed for the smaller CPC which limits, or makes it awkward, for our Irish counterparts as I understand it.

    Also I know domestic lights need RCD protection, however is there any point in this case with no earth in the circuit.

    • @dsesuk
      @dsesuk  Месяц назад

      It's amazing how execution of a will can divide a family. Once any in-fighting starts, the only people who end up winning are the solicitors. As for RCD protection on the lighting, the lack of a CPC makes it especially important to have. An RCD has no connection to earth and doesn't rely on a CPC to be present or even the main earthing to be working. Let's say someone in the future wants to change a light fitting here and they fail to isolate the circuit. They grab the line wire and current flows from source, through them, down their step ladder and into physical earth. In this case, presence of a CPC or supplier's earth isn't relevant even if present, but the RCD will detect the current down line isn't returning via neutral and will duly click off. Not all 'earth leakages' happen down a CPC.
